
Raleigh looks pretty good from street level, but sometimes you need a higher vantage point. From downtown terraces overlooking the skyline to polished rooftop restaurants in North Hills, these are five of our favorite places to get above it all.
Perched atop the AC Hotel Raleigh Downtown, The Willard combines sweeping city views with cocktails, small plates and a sophisticated atmosphere. Multiple outdoor terraces make it an especially good pick for sunset drinks, date night or kicking off an evening downtown. It remains one of Raleigh's signature rooftop experiences.
Fourteen stories above downtown, Urban Oak gives Raleigh a genuinely elevated rooftop experience. Firepits, contemporary furnishings and wraparound views set the scene, while cocktails, bubbly, flatbreads and sliders make it easy to settle in for the evening. It's particularly convenient before or after a show at Red Hat Amphitheater.
North Hills has its own rooftop destination at Level7. Located atop the AC Hotel, the lounge pairs elevated views with cocktails and comfortable seating, giving Midtown Raleigh a stylish alternative to the downtown rooftop circuit.
Come for lunch or dinner and stay for the setting. RH Rooftop Restaurant brings a more design-forward approach to rooftop dining, making it a natural choice for brunches, celebrations and date nights where the surroundings matter almost as much as what's on the table. It was also singled out by Best of Raleigh for its aesthetic setting.
A longtime downtown favorite, Raleigh Times occupies the former home of its namesake newspaper and adds a rooftop component to one of the city's most recognizable bars. It's a good choice when you want something more casual: grab a beer, head upstairs and take in downtown from above.
